买回来mac book pro,至于为什么买mac也是受了一些鼓动吧,一方面是自己之前装ubuntu用了段时间,还是觉得系统的稳定性不给力,虽然已经做的蛮不错了,但是用了一会会假死,然后装在我的dell机器上,分了30g空间给ubuntu,导致windows的空间严重告急了,本来想买个移动硬盘缓解下,看看价格还是没下手。不过真心是想在类linux环境下工作,开发。
后来某天突然去关注了下苹果,看到网上的文章:为什么国外程序员爱用mac,地址为:http://www.vpsee.com/2009/06/why-programmers-love-mac/
文章下网友的讨论还是蛮有意思的,大部分还是倾向于买mac,虽然价格是稍微贵了点,但是咬咬牙,还是买的起的吧。看完就有了些冲动,看中的md 313 ,价格是最便宜的,我对配置要求不高,但是当时看了下京东的价格,8499,就寻思着要不等等看是否降价。大概过了两星期降到8299了,又等了一两个星期,价格就定格了。然后也又去关注淘宝上的价格,又8000左右的,也有7000多的,基本上就是国行和港行之分了。终于某个周五,突然心血来潮,果断下了单,店家跟我联系,让我自提,所以直接5点左右杀过去,取了回来。
前阶段在搞logsystem,没什么时间去研究以及适应mac os.清明节三天,没出去玩,刚好去小研究下。
触摸板真不是盖的,终于让我相信代替鼠标是可以做到的。使用的过程中,也遇到一些不习惯的地方,从windows 向mac转,有些习惯还没改过来。比如,页面的滚动,mac下方向是相反的。还有快捷键的问题,都需要慢慢适应。
装了一些软件,比如office,qq,ali wangwang,这些软件是必备的。
然后开发环境,装上 intellij idea,还好支持mac,的确牛。
装的过程中,发现mac比较好玩的地方,安装软件直接是拖动到applications文件夹下,即为安装,卸载直接删除即可。基本上这种做法等同于90%以上的软件为绿色软件哈。
mac还有一点非常好,当我用idea 将logsystem 从公司仓库check out下来后,准备配置maven路径,后来准备下载配置环境变量时发现系统已经自带了。很多开发用到的工具,包括maven,junit,httpd,derby等。
软件包的下载之类的,在unbuntu下用apt-get居多。在mac下mac ports也是用来干类似的事情的,这个等以后实际用到再去研究吧。
然后为了能够访问公司的网络,把vpn也配置了下,
mac下下vpn软件可以用如下:anyconnect-macosx-i386-2.4.0202-k9.dmg
还有访问内网的证书也导入了浏览器。safari不支持证书文件导入,后只能用chrome,本来还想用safari来着,发现导入证书与导入书签都不行,遂还是用chrome吧。
这几天也看了些苹果的东西,包括大家对mac book pro的设计以及mac os.
在知呼上有不少讨论:
http://www.zhihu.com/question/19592717
- 大小: 68.5 KB
分享到:
相关推荐
无Mac机IOS开发环境搭建手记
北斗物联网监控平台mac开发环境搭建1
Mac OS X下搭建nRF52832开发环境使用(GCC和Eclipse) 可通过 Jlink-OB 在线调试开发,蓝牙低功耗芯片 nRF52832 512k M4F 内核比 CC2640 更强,更方便
整个Android开发环境的搭建过程,有图有真相(Mac平台的).
android_MAC系统Eclipse开发环境搭建.pdf
android_MAC系统Eclipse开发环境搭建借鉴.pdf
主要总结在基于Ubuntu14.04系统上搭建区块链开发平台的过程。目前搭建区块链开发环境还是比较复杂,推荐使用Mac OS X和Linux操作系统,目前不建议使用Windows,可能会碰到各种各样的问题,最后导致放弃。
里比较详细的来总结下mac开发android的环境搭建步骤安装过程,希望对一些正准备配置Android开发环境的小伙伴们有一定帮助
android_MAC系统Eclipse开发环境搭建[整理].pdf
XE6移动开发环境搭建之IOS篇(3):配置虚拟机,设置Mac安装环境(有图有真相) 27 XE6移动开发环境搭建之IOS篇(4):VMware9里安装Mac OSX 10.8(有图有真相) 52 XE6移动开发环境搭建之IOS篇(5):解决Windows和...
自己总结的 非常详细的在虚拟机vmware6.5上搭建苹果操作系统10.5.5
Win7环境下安装Mac OS双系统及Iphone开发SDK iphone开发环境搭建
在MAC环境下搭建cocos2d-x开发环境
1. Android on Mac 搭建开发环境
文件里面包含搭建gogs环境搭建需要的软件资料。... Gogs (Go Git Service) ...使用 Go 语言开发使得 Gogs 能够通过独立的二进制分发,并且支持 Go 语言支持的 所有平台,包括 Linux、Mac OS X、Windows 以及 ARM 平台。
IOS开发的高成本一直是许多开发者的一个难题,本文档详细讲解了非MAC如何搭建iOS开发环境
在Mac上搭建Titanium的iOS开发环境
IOS开发环境搭建,vmware mac xcode
JavaFX+Jfoenix 学习笔记(一)--环境搭建及多款Hello World演示的源码 JavaFX的简单展示,主要是为了配合文章学习使用
VMware8.0.4安装Mac10.7.5及Xcode记录(IOS开发环境搭建),详细的图文解说,如有任何不明白的可以去我的博客。